The Ovulation Test Market is a rapidly growing segment of the healthcare industry that focuses on providing women with a reliable method to track their ovulation cycles. Ovulation, the release of a mature egg from the ovaries, plays a crucial role in fertility and conception. Ovulation tests are designed to detect the surge in luteinizing hormone (LH) that occurs just before ovulation, helping women identify their most fertile days.

Ovulation tests are simple, convenient, and non-invasive tools that have gained immense popularity among women trying to conceive or monitor their reproductive health. These tests are available in various formats, including urine-based ovulation test strips, digital ovulation tests, and fertility monitors. The market for ovulation tests is driven by increasing awareness about fertility and the growing demand for effective family planning methods.

Category-wise Insights

  1. Urine-based Ovulation Test Strips: This category represents the most commonly used and affordable ovulation test option. These test strips rely on color changes to indicate LH surge, providing a cost-effective solution for women tracking their ovulation.
  2. Digital Ovulation Tests: Digital tests offer a more user-friendly approach, providing clear digital results and eliminating the need for interpreting color changes. These tests are popular among women seeking a convenient and easy-to-read ovulation test option.
  3. Fertility Monitors: Fertility monitors combine ovulation testing with advanced technology, offering features such as Bluetooth connectivity and fertility tracking apps. These monitors provide comprehensive fertility information and personalized insights, attracting tech-savvy consumers.
